The WeldingStop Auto-Darkening Welding Goggles provide a convenient and portable solution for small welding and grinding jobs. They are not as bulky as a traditional helmet and are designed to be easily carried, making them perfect for quick tasks. These goggles offer a clear view with a fast reaction time, and they come with various lenses for different needs. However, they are not suitable for large or long-duration projects as they don’t provide sufficient protection and can feel a bit heavy. Some users have also noted issues with the auto-darkening feature, the lack of a manual, and the difficulty of replacing the batteries. Read more…
